Meaning of You Should Be Dead by 50 Cent

In the world of hip-hop, 50 Cent is no stranger to delivering hard-hitting tracks that reflect his tough upbringing and experiences. One such song that embodies his gritty style is "You Should Be Dead". This song delves into the dark and dangerous side of life, presenting a narrative filled with violence, loyalty, and survival.At its core, the overall theme of the song revolves around the consequences of betrayal and the harsh reality of street life. It serves as a cautionary tale, warning listeners about the price one might pay for crossing the wrong person or getting caught up in a web of deceit.One standout lyric that helps develop the theme is "I rock a nigga to sleep, rock-rock-a-bye, baby." This line evokes images of an unsettling lullaby, where 50 Cent becomes the ominous figure singing a deadly tune. It conveys the idea that trust can be shattered, and those who deceive or betray others may ultimately meet their demise.Another important lyric is "Yeah I show you my teeth all through the beef, paint the sidewalk red with the back of your head." This line hints at the brutal violence that permeates the narrator's world. It reflects the merciless nature of street conflicts and underscores the consequences of getting involved in such a dangerous lifestyle.The hook itself, "You should be dead by now, smile but wait until my shooters come round, with the talons and hollow tip rounds," maintains a consistent motif throughout the song. It serves as a chilling reminder that vengeance is inevitable, and those who have wronged the narrator will face a grim fate.Beyond the surface-level interpretation of violence and retribution, there are unexpected thematic layers that can be explored. One such imaginative theme is the notion of survival tactics in a hostile environment. The lyrics depict a world where individuals must rely on their instincts to stay alive, using whatever means necessary to protect themselves and their loved ones.Moreover, the song can also be seen as a commentary on the cyclical nature of violence and how it perpetuates more violence. The references to frequent shootouts and constant tension illustrate a never-ending cycle of revenge and retaliation. It suggests that once caught up in this world, it becomes increasingly challenging to break free from its clutches, leading to a continuous cycle of bloodshed.Furthermore, the lyrics hint at the importance of loyalty and the consequences that come with betrayal. The references to "shooters" and the relentless pursuit of justice illustrate a code that cannot be broken. The narrator's unwavering determination to avenge those who have been wronged speaks to the value of loyalty among those who share a common background and understanding.In conclusion, "You Should Be Dead" is a raw and gripping track that depicts the harsh realities of street life and the consequences of betrayal. Through its vivid lyrics, it explores themes of violence, survival, loyalty, and the cyclical nature of revenge. While it may seem like an intense and straightforward song on the surface, a deeper analysis unveils unexpected and imaginative themes that enrich the overall message.
